Step by step : a pedestrian memoir

Block, Lawrence. (Author).

Summary: From the bestselling author comes a touching, insightful, and humorous memoir of an unlikely racewalker and world traveler. Before Lawrence Block was the author of bestselling novels, he was a walker. As a child, he walked home from school. As a college student, he walked until he was able to buy his first car. As an adult, he ran marathons until he discovered what would become a lifelong obsession--never mind if some people didn't think it was a real sport--racewalking. Racewalking ended up taking him all over the country. Through the lens of his adventures while walking--in twenty-four-hour races, on a pilgrimage through Spain, and just about everywhere you can imagine--Block shares his heartwarming personal story about life's trials and tribulations, discomforts and successes, which truly lets readers walk a mile in the master of mystery's shoes.--From publisher description.
